机器人又学了哪些新本领(经济聚焦)
Ren Min Ri Bao· 2025-08-10 22:20
Core Insights - The 2025 World Robot Conference held in Beijing showcased over 200 domestic and international robot companies, with more than 1,500 exhibits and over 100 new products launched, emphasizing the integration of robotics into various sectors [2][4][6] Industry Development - China's robot industry revenue grew by 27.8% year-on-year in the first half of the year, with industrial robots and service robots seeing production increases of 35.6% and 25.5% respectively, maintaining its position as the world's largest industrial robot market [6][10] - The country is projected to have a robot patent application volume accounting for two-thirds of the global total by 2024, indicating a strong focus on innovation and technology development in the robotics sector [4][5] Technological Innovation - The Beijing Humanoid Robot Innovation Center introduced several innovative technologies, including a multi-modal large model and an autonomous navigation system for humanoid robots, supporting the large-scale application of embodied intelligence [4][11] - Advanced humanoid robots are now capable of complex movements and tasks, with improvements in AI control algorithms leading to enhanced stability and responsiveness [5][11] Application Scenarios - Industrial robots are now applied across 71 major sectors of the national economy, with a significant increase in the density of robots in China's manufacturing industry, ranking third globally [11][12] - The conference highlighted diverse applications of robots in various fields, including industrial automation, scientific research, and service industries, showcasing their potential to transform traditional practices [9][10] Ecosystem Development - Beijing is establishing a comprehensive ecosystem for the robotics industry, with over 300 companies in the region and initiatives to support innovation and collaboration among various stakeholders [7][12] - The city plans to launch a social experiment program for embodied intelligence, creating a data pool for training models and enhancing the capabilities of humanoid robots [12][13]
